#4b0699 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4b0699 is composed of 29.4% red, 2.4% green and 60%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 51% cyan, 96.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 40% black. It has a hue angle of 268.2 degrees, a saturation of 92.5% and a lightness of 31.2%. #4b0699 color hex could be obtained by blending #960cff with #000033. Closest websafe color is: #330099.

Shades and Tints of #4b0699

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010002 is the darkest color, while #f6eefe is the lightest one.

Tones of #4b0699

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4f4f50 is the less saturated color, while #4b0699 is the most saturated one.
